UK: Asantehene visits V&A museum
The King of the Asante Kingdom, Otumfuo Osei Tutu II has paid a visit to the Victoria and Albert (V&A) Museum, one of the two British museums that lent back a few looted Asante artefacts in their possession and on display in their galleries in the United Kingdom (UK).
His Majesty’s visit to the place on Thursday, July 18, 2024, is ahead of his scheduled lecture at the British Museum on July 19, 2024
As part of the visit, Otumfuo toured the museum’s gallery and held a private conversation with the museum management led by Director Tristram Hunt.
The King by this visit and subsequent lecture seeks to acquire more of his bona fide properties in the possession of these two Museums.
